5 Cozy Japandi Bedroom Decor Ideas for a Peaceful Sanctuary

A Japandi bedroom is designed to be a peaceful sanctuary where the mind can reset. To achieve this, keep the layout close to the floor by opting for a low platform wooden bed. The lower profile instantly creates a feeling of spaciousness and rest. Choose bedding made of natural, breathable fibers like washed linen or organic cotton in earth tones—beige, clay, sage, or sand. Layer the textures rather than introducing loud colors. Style a bedside table with a warm-light dome lamp and a single branch in a ceramic vase to keep the visual field calm and structured.

To emphasize the Japanese design influence, introduce low-profile wooden storage and minimalist sliding elements. Keeping dressers and wardrobes clean and free of metal hardware aligns the furniture with organic nature. A simple shoji-inspired paper screen or soft linen divider can help hide clothing rails, maintaining the room's serene visual flow. By replacing heavy, dark furniture with light ash or oak wood alternatives, the bedroom gains a peaceful feeling of weightlessness.

Lastly, keep your windows as unobstructed as possible to allow soft, natural morning light to filter in. Replace heavy blackout drapes with light-filtering linen curtains. The sight of morning sun rays crossing textured linen bedcovers creates a beautiful connection with nature, which is the ultimate goal of any Japandi-inspired space. Place a soft woven jute mat or a wool rug at the side of the bed to greet your feet in the morning, grounding the space in raw warmth.
